/* Pietrino EDS - Tema Classico */
.pietrino-widget { background: #fff; border-color: #e8dcc8; }
.pietrino-header { background: #fff; }
.pietrino-logo-mark { background: #B8860B; }
.pietrino-logo-text { color: #1a1a1a; }
.pietrino-mode-badge { background: #F5E6C0; color: #7A5C00; }
.pietrino-mode-studio { background: #E1F5EE; color: #0F6E56; }
.pietrino-topic-banner { background: #FAF3E0; color: #7A5C00; }
.pietrino-tabs { background: #faf6ee; }
.pietrino-tab { color: #888; }
.pietrino-tab:hover { color: #1a1a1a; }
.pietrino-tab.active { color: #B8860B; border-bottom-color: #B8860B; }
.pietrino-body { background: #fff; }
.pietrino-msg-user { background: #B8860B; color: #fff; }
.pietrino-msg-ai { background: #f5f0e8; color: #1a1a1a; }
.pietrino-msg-thinking { background: #f5f0e8; color: #888; }
.pietrino-input { border-color: #e0d5c0; background: #fff; color: #1a1a1a; }
.pietrino-input:focus { border-color: #B8860B; }
.pietrino-send-btn { background: #B8860B; color: #fff; }
.pietrino-btn-primary { background: #B8860B; color: #fff; }
.pietrino-btn-secondary { background: #fff; color: #1a1a1a; border: 1px solid #ddd; }
.pietrino-area-card:hover, .pietrino-area-card.selected { border-color: #B8860B; background: #FAF3E0; }
.pietrino-area-card .dashicons { color: #B8860B; }
.pietrino-field { border-color: #e0d5c0; background: #fff; color: #1a1a1a; }
.pietrino-field:focus { border-color: #B8860B; }
.pietrino-analysis-label { color: #B8860B; }
.pietrino-section-error .pietrino-analysis-label { color: #A32D2D; }
.pietrino-section-highlight { background: #FAF3E0; border-left-color: #B8860B; }
.pietrino-section-highlight .pietrino-analysis-label { color: #7A5C00; }
.pietrino-upload-area { border-color: #ddd; }
.pietrino-studio-intro { background: #E1F5EE; border-color: #9FE1CB; color: #0F6E56; }
